Round Lake Area Schools District 116 is proud to recognize seven staff members who have been nominated for the 2026 Educator of the Year Awards through the Lake County Regional Office of Education. These individuals exemplify excellence in teaching, leadership, and service, and reflect the profound impact our educators and staff have on students, families, and the broader community.

Each nominee will be recognized alongside colleagues from across Lake County at the 5th Annual Educator of the Year Awards Banquet on Wednesday, May 6.

Additionally, two outstanding team members will also be recognized for significant professional achievements:

  • Brian Peterson (Round Lake High School) will be recognized for earning the Illinois Principals Association Lake Region High School Principal of the Year Award.
  • Carolyn Corcoran (CTE/CBE C&I Specialist) will be recognized for her impactful work with Navig8Lake.
